About Mindroom

Mindroom is a Scottish charity dedicated to creating and raising awareness of learning difficulties. We are also passionate about providing direct help and support for children and adults with learning difficulties and their families.


Mindroom’s 2020 Vision


Mindroom's goal is to create such awareness, that by the year 2020 all children and adults in this country with learning difficulties will receive the recognition and help they need.



We will work towards our 2020 vision by:


  • Offering direct help and support
  • Arranging high profile conferences
  • Setting up multi-disciplinary diagnostic centres - Mindrooms
  • Setting up specialist schools


Mindroom was founded in 2001 by Sophie Dow, a journalist and mother of two. Her daughter Annie has severe learning difficulties and is the inspiration behind Mindroom.



We are a recognised Scottish charity SC 030472.

We are also a company limited by guarantee and recognised in Scotland SC 209656


Established 2001

Other Mindroom Activities

  • “It Takes All Kinds Of Minds” – production of a highly popular support pack for teaching professionals on meeting and accommodating learning difficulties in the classroom. Supported and sponsored by Royal Mail Education, the pack is currently on its 4th print run, with 80,000 already distributed.

  • Mindroom Information Guide To Your Essential Rights - Booklet containing vital information to rights, services, education, mediation and more.

  • Camp Kasper – we have facilitated summer camps for children with learning difficulties


  • Royal Mail Inclusion Policy – Mindroom has collaborated with the Royal Mail on recruiting staff with learning difficulties.


Direct help and support

Launched in Spring 2005, Mindroom offers outreach services through tailored talks and presentations on request. We also respond to enquiries and offer individual support and information.

Present

We are working towards establishing a ground-breaking multi disciplinary Mindroom Centre, with diagnostic clinic, and research and educational facilities, all under one roof.


We continue to create awareness about learning difficulties by collaborating with universities, employers, schools, the medical profession, social  services, the arts world, professional organisations and of course, families.
